What fertilizer is best for persimmon trees?

Persimmons are native to China, and there are persimmon trees along the rivers. The roots of persimmon trees are very strong and developed, but it is difficult for the roots to heal themselves after being injured, so you should pay attention to the concentration and amount of fertilizer when applying fertilizer to avoid damaging the roots. Persimmon trees have strong adaptability and can adapt well to both acidic and alkaline fertilizers. Generally speaking, producing one ton of persimmons requires a large amount of nitrogen and potassium fertilizers, and a small amount of phosphorus. Among them, persimmon trees have the greatest demand for nitrogen.

Fertilizer for Persimmon Trees

1. Fertilizer

According to modern agricultural research, 1 ton of persimmons requires approximately 8-9kg of nitrogen, 6-7kg of potassium, and 2-3kg of phosphorus. Overall, the demand for nitrogen fertilizer is the greatest, so special attention should be paid when choosing fertilizers.

2. Planting and fertilization

Because the persimmon tree has a very developed root system, it must be planted deep when transplanting. Then, mix the farmyard manure and superphosphate evenly and put it in the planting hole. This will be beneficial to the growth and development of the roots.

3. Base fertilizer

After winter, all the leaves of the persimmon tree will fall off. It is time to start applying base fertilizer. Mix phosphorus and potassium fertilizers with farmyard manure evenly, and then apply fertilizer according to the actual growth situation of each tree. Then mix the fertilizer and soil evenly and fill the ditch.

Fertilization method for persimmon trees

1. Topdressing

Persimmon trees need topdressing during their growth and development period to make up for the deficiency of basal fertilizer. Usually, livestock manure, biogas sludge and quick-acting chemical fertilizers are mainly used, and they are applied every 20 days or so.

2. Foliar fertilization

Foliar fertilization is a method of topdressing based on the actual growth conditions of the persimmon tree. You can use amino acids, foliar fertilizers, high potassium, more than 98% potassium dihydrogen phosphate organic fertilizers, trace element concentration fertilizers, etc. It is best to do it in the morning, evening or on cloudy days.

3. Amount of fertilizer

The amount of fertilizer applied is generally based on the conditions of the soil and the persimmon tree. Usually, if the soil is sandy or clay, it is best to apply organic fertilizer. If the persimmon tree is older, the amount of fertilizer applied should be increased accordingly.
